37403Microsoft Visual C++ .Net Step by Step
This intuitive, self paced learning system makes it easy for developers to teach themselves how to draw on all the power of Microsoft Visual C++, and to see how Visual C++ compares with other popular development languages. Developers learn C++ by following step by step instructions with numerous high quality code examples all created specifically for this book.

37405Microsoft Windows 2000 core requirements, exam 70-215: Microsoft Windows 2000 Server
Written for information technology professionals who plan to take the Microsoft Certified Professional exam 70-215: Installing, Configuring, and Administering Microsoft Windows 2000 Server. Topics include unattended installations, file systems, active directory services, network protocols, security, and other issues. The CD-ROM contains supplemental articles and files for use in hands-on exercises.

37407Microsoft Windows 2000 performance tuning technical reference
This Technical Reference offers ready advice on how to implement, configure, and run Windows 2000 Server-based systems for faster, more stable, and more efficient performance. It covers issues such as optimization and replication of the Active Directory service across enterprise networks, domains in LAN and WAN networks, and Web hosting -- making it a comprehensive roadmap to Windows 2000 performance tuning.
37408Microsoft Windows Server 2003 Unleashed : 2nd edition
Through the release of several feature packs, Microsoft has added 15 new features to their Windows Server 2003. As an IT professional, you are probably aware of what these features are and have installed them, but you may not be aware of what their full capability is and how to troubleshoot the system with them in place. Sams has published a second edition of the best selling Microsoft Windows Server 2003 Unleashed as an updated reference guide in response to these new features. Learn about the new Group Policy Management Console, Timewarp Client, Security Configuration Wizard and more as you plan, implement and administer your Windows 2003 environment.

37410Microsoft Word 2007: A Professional Approach
The Professional Approach Series is designed for students unfamiliar with the Microsoft Office Suite, or even students who are nervous about trying to learn computer skills. It is ideal for students who are new to the world of computers, yet in-depth enough to teach and challenge more savvy users. Each lesson contains up to 25 skill-applications and 5 end-of-unit skill-applications that take students from simple to complex situations. The Office 2007 texts complete instruction in all skill sets and activities for the appropriate MCAS Exams.
